Essential Functions:
* Plan, prioritize, and assign daily maintenance work based on production schedule, safety needs, and asset criticality.
* Establish a culture of reliability, craftsmanship, and continuous improvement.
* Manage contractor activities, ensuring work meets engineering requirements, quality standards, and timelines.
* Oversee maintenance budgeting, spare parts management, and procurement of tools, equipment, and services.
* Ensure compliance with safety procedures, facility codes, and operational regulations.
* Serve as the technical authority for plant equipment, utilities, mechanical systems, and facility operations.
* Lead root cause analysis investigations and implement permanent corrective actions for equipment or facility failures.
* Develop, implement, and continuously improve preventative and predictive maintenance programs, including PM schedules, documentation, KPIs, and compliance tracking.
* Maintain and improve mechanical, electrical, hydraulic, and pneumatic systems supporting aerospace production.
* Coordinate facility upgrades, utility improvements, expansions, and infrastructure modifications (HVAC changes, machinery moves, lighting, foundations, space optimization).
* Maintain accurate maintenance records, equipment histories, and engineering documentation.
* Partner with Production and Engineering to ensure equipment readiness and support new manufacturing processes.
* Interface with EHS to ensure safe work practices and hazard mitigation across facility systems.
* Support capital projects, equipment selection, and long-term planning for facility and infrastructure growth.
* Communicate maintenance status, project progress, and reliability metrics to leadership.
Qualifications:
* Bachelor's degree in applicable field required and 5+ years of experience in facilities management, maintenance management, industrial maintenance, manufacturing support, equipment maintenance, or related operational roles.
* Proven ability to troubleshoot and repair complex mechanical systems (pumps, gearboxes, compressors, hydraulic/pneumatic systems).
* Working knowledge of electrical systems, schematics, controls wiring, and instrumentation.
* Demonstrated experience creating, managing, or improving preventative maintenance programs.
* Proficiency with Microsoft Word and Excel for documentation, reporting, and data tracking.
* Effective communication skills in English;
Spanish language is a plus.
* Ability to work primarily day shift with occasional off-shift or weekend support during critical repairs or upgrades.
* PLC knowledge or controls experience (training can be provided).
* Limited electrical maintenance license.
* Prior leadership or supervisory experience in a maintenance environment.
* Experience in aerospace or composite manufacturing.
* Experience with machining equipment (lathe, mill, drill press).
* Familiarity with continuous improvement, root-cause analysis, lean manufacturing, or reliability engineering principles.
